A letter of support from SPPS or from the partner may be the first step in an active and engaged partnership. When you ask for a letter of support on your projects, it demonstrates a commitment from you, the partner, and from SPPS in the following areas:

  • The district's overall strategic framework for the advancement of education shall be made clear prior to the engaging of any partnership or project. The proposed project will, in turn, clearly state how it advances the strategic framework toward an achievable end.
  • Communication shall be made by leaders in all the organizations in a regular, timely and efficient manner with all key staff involved from the partner organization. All reports will be completed in a timely, efficient manner as prescribed by the contract.
  • Our partners agree that the interests of SPPS and its students are to be protected in all situations. The partner understands that coordination of services will happen within the district to ensure the safety, security and confidentiality of our students.
  • The district will serve as a committed partner to the partner in all situations. The district will have active leadership and connection in all proposals.

In order to process a request for a letter of support, please submit the following paperwork, and submit it to the Fund Development Coordinator:

  • A draft of the letter of support
  • A Request for Proposal
  • A draft of the grant
  • A draft of the budget
  • A cover sheet with summary and routing information (attached)

The Fund Development Coordinator will complete the following:

  • Review and revise as necessary
  • Determine the signatures necessary and route paperwork.
  • Return original signed letter according to requester directions
